How they compare

Oman currently reports 12,334 Kilotonnes of CO2-equivalent against 1,796 Kilotonnes of CO2-equivalent in Slovenia, a difference of 10,538 Kilotonnes of CO2-equivalent.

That makes Oman's figure about 6.9 times Slovenia's.

Across all 21 years both countries report, Oman has been ahead every year.

Oman ranks 37th and Slovenia ranks 40th of 166 countries.

Oman has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

The Statistical Annex to the annual Africa's Development Dynamics (AFDD) report is a collection of development indicators that were gathered and analysed while conducting the research that went into the report. These data are also available online for free viewing or download at https://oe.cd/AFDD-2024, a bilingual website which links to the electronic version of the Africa's Development Dynamics book in both English and French. Table 25 shows statistics on GHG emissions from different sources.
